Driver na naka-alitan ng isang babaeng motovlogger, wala umanong balak magpa-areglo

The driver who was involved in a traffic-rule argument with a female motovlogger was not planning to withdraw the charges he was planning to file against the latter.

In a Facebook post, the driver, Jimmy Pascua, and his family announced their intention to file multiple charges against motovlogger Yanna for allegedly defaming him and posting their encounter on social media without his permission.

According to some legal experts, Yanna may have committed a privacy violation against Pascua.

Yanna returned to Zambales to talk personally to Pascua, but she failed to meet the latter.

“Earlier, di po namin naabutan si Kuya Jimmy Pascua in his house, and in his work to personally apologize, so I would like to take this opportunity to say sorry to Kuya Jimmy for what I’ve cost,” she said.

“Of course, as well as to those people who got dragged into the issue,” she added.

Meanwhile, Harry James Pascua, who introduced himself as the son of the driver, said that they wanted to teach the motovlogger a lesson.

“Hinding-hindi po kami magpapa-areglo. Grabe pong kahihiyan ang binigay mo sa Papa ko ma’am. Tinanggalan mo siya ng dignidad! Dapat po sa inyo ay maturuan ng leksyon,” he said.
